
Two weeks after deciding to accept public assistance in the form of free nannies, Nadya Suleman has fired the free nursing staff provided to her by the non-profit charity organization Angels In Waiting. According to US:
Suleman had several confrontations with the nurses, her attorney Jeff Czech said. Relations worsened Sunday when Suleman came to believe that Angels in Waiting founder Linda West-Conforti was allegedly filing a report against her with child welfare officials.
Suleman — who has custody of four infants so far — says she’ll rely on her own nannies — whom she had planned to hire regardless of Angels in Waiting’s assistance — to care for the babies instead.
Suleman turned down an earlier offer from Angels in Waiting because they wouldn’t let her film a reality show, Allred said.
